A ditch-loving ecologist with an unmatched local perspective of the Fens
About this Event

Dr Laurie Friday is a scientist and champion of the Fens, especially Wicken Fen.

Laurie has dedicated much of her career to understanding and protecting wetlands. As a freshwater ecologist at the University of Cambridge, her research and leadership have helped shape how we think about landscapes like the Fens, where nature, climate, farming and communities are all deeply connected.

Laurie works with the University of Cambridge’s Centre for Landscape Regeneration, helping bring scientists, farmers and conservationists together to tackle some of the biggest challenges facing the Fens today, from biodiversity loss to climate change. Together they are exploring how we can restore nature, manage water, store carbon and sustain food production in the Fen landscape for generations to come.

This talk is offered in partnership with Cambridge University's Centre for Landscape Regeneration. Please look out for more talks in our Fenland Folk: Heritage and Landscape series.
